   This proposed change modifies the tooltip on the Tree View to include "Next 
Execution Date". I've found that Airflow scheduling work at the end of a 
schedule interval is a common source of confusion for my users. When they see 
on the tree view that the "last run" was one schedule interval away from the 
current time, they often raise questions about why the latest run hasn't kicked 
off yet.
   
   I believe that showing both execution date and next execution date in this 
tooltip better illustrates the window of time that their Airflow task is 
operating on.
